What documents are needed for an H4 visa EAD?
I may not want to miss even a single document from the list hence pasting a link below which is a step by step guide for obtaining H4 EADhttp://www.immihelp.com/h4-visa-...Eligibility RequirementsYou are eligible if you are the H-4 dependent spouse of an H-1B nonimmigrant if your H-1B nonimmigrant spouse:Is the principal beneficiary of an approved Form I-140, Immigrant Petition for Alien Worker; orHas been granted H-1B status under sections 106(a) and (b) of the AC21. The AC21 permits H-1B nonimmigrants seeking employment-based lawful permanent residence to work and remain in the United States beyond the six-year limit.How to ApplyYou must file Form I-765 and receive an Employment Authorization Document (EAD/Form I-766) from USCIS before you may begin working.While USCIS currently is continuing to accept the older version of Form I-765 with an edition date of 5/27/08 or later, we encourage H-4 applicants to use the newer version with an edition date of 2/13/15 in order to prevent delays or the need for USCIS to issue you a request for evidence.Carefully follow these steps to prevent your application from being rejected and returned to you:Complete Form I-765 using the Instructions for Form I-765. USCIS will reject any application that is not accompanied by the proper filing fees or signature. The fee is $380. You cannot file Form I-765 for category (c)(26) together with a Form I-485, Application to Register Permanent Residence or Adjust Status at the Lockbox address for Form I-765 category (c)(26). If filing a Form I-485, you must follow the Form I-485 filing instructions and submit your Form I-485 to the correct filing address for that form. If you file a Form I-765 together with a Form I-485 at the filing address for Form I-765 category (c)(26), USCIS will reject your Form I-485 and any corresponding fees. Additionally, if you included the fees for both forms on the same check or money order, USCIS may also reject your Form I-765 for category (c)(26). Note: If you are filing Form I-765 together with Form I-485 at the USCIS location noted for Form I-485, you should specify your work eligibility category as (c)(9) and pay only the Form I-485 filing fee (and not the Form I-765 filing fee) to avoid processing delays.u00a0u00a0 Submit supporting evidence (see chart below). Submitting sufficient supporting evidence will minimize the likelihood that USCIS will need to send you a request for more evidence.u00a0Evidence ofu2026Can be shown by submittingu2026Your H-4 statusA copy of your most recent Form I-797, Notice of Action, for Form I-539, Application to Extend/Change Nonimmigrant Status; orA copy of Form I-94, Arrival/Departure Record, showing your admission or extension of stay as an H-4 nonimmigrant.A government-issued identification document with photoA copy of your last EAD (if any);A copy of the biometric page of your passport;A birth certificate with photo ID;A visa issued by a foreign consulate; orA national identity document with photo.Your relationship to theH-1B nonimmigrantu00a0A copy of your marriage certificate.Your basis for eligibilityEvidence that the H-1B nonimmigrant is the principal beneficiary of an approved Immigrant Petition for Alien Worker (Form I-140). You may show this by submitting a copy of the H-1B nonimmigrantu2019s Form I-797 approval notice for Form I-140;OREvidence that the H-1B nonimmigrant has received an extension of stay under AC21 sections 106(a) and (b).You may show this by submitting:1.u00a0 A copy of the H-1B nonimmigrantu2019s passports, prior Forms I-94 (Arrival/Departure Record), and current and prior Forms I-797 for Form I-129, Petition for a Nonimmigrant Worker; and2.u00a0 Evidence to establish one of the following bases for the H-1B nonimmigrantu2019s extension of stay:Based on Filing of a Permanent Labor Certification Application. Submit evidence that the H-1B nonimmigrant is the beneficiary of a Permanent Labor Certification Application that was filed at least 365 days prior to the expiration of the six-year limitation of stay. You may show this by submitting a copy of a print out from the Department of Laboru2019s (DOLu2019s) website or other correspondence from DOL showing the status of the H-1B nonimmigrantu2019s Permanent Labor Certification Application. If DOL certified the Permanent Labor Certification, also submit a copy of Form I-797 Notice of Receipt for Form I-140 establishing that the Form I-140 was filed within 180 days of DOL certifying the Permanent Labor Certification;u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0u00a0 ORBased on a Pending Form I-140. If the preference category sought for the H-1B nonimmigrant does not require a Permanent Labor Certification Application with DOL, submit evidence that the H-1B nonimmigrantu2019s Form I-140 was filed at least 365 days prior to the expiration of the six-year limitation of stay and remains pending. You may show this by submitting a copy of the Form I-797 Notice of Receipt for Form I-140.Examples of Secondary Evidence. If you do not have any evidence relating to the H-1B nonimmigrant as described in u201cau201d or u201cbu201d above, you may ask USCIS to consider secondary evidence in support of your application for work authorization as an H-4 spouse. For example, such information may include the receipt number of the H-1B nonimmigrant's most current Form I-129 extension of stay request or the receipt number of the H-1B nonimmigrant's approved Form I-140 petition. Failure to prnecessary information about the H-1B nonimmigrant may result in a delay in the adjudication or denial of your application for employment authorization.Photos for card productionTwo identical two-by-two-inch passport-style color photographs of yourselfHope this helps

What are the necessary steps to apply for a green card for a F1 student who is currently married with a US citizen?
You will have to file for adjustment of status in the U.S. The basic steps are as follows:Your relative (spouse) will have to file I-130 for your benefit as an immediate relative of a US citizen. Petition for Alien RelativeYou have to file form I-485 to apply for the green card. Application to Register Permanent Residence or Adjust StatusYou should also file, although not required I-765 (application for employment authorization) Application for Employment AuthorizationRead the instructions of each document and send them with all supporting documents and payment to the Chicago lockbox as indicated by USCIS: Direct Filing Addresses for Form I-485, Application to Register Permanent Residence or Adjust StatusSupporting documents will include:picturespassport, visa, i-94 photo copiesbirth certificate (for your and your spouse to prove citizenship or naturalization certificate)marriage certificateany joint assets (bank account, car titles, home deed)other joint documents (car insurance, health insurance, credit card with both names, utilities, joint travel: hotel bills, boarding pass, tickets etc.)pictures of you together, with family etc.Basically you have to prove you are who you say you are, your spouse is a citizen, you guys have a bona fide marriage.Once you file you will get an appointment for fingerprinting. In a few months you will get a appointment with local USCIS officer. You must both present yourself and prany additional documents to prove bona fide marriage.Itu2019s a fairly straight forward process. Good luck.
For some reason my EAD card was not delivered and has been sent back to the USCIS. My 90-day unemployment period is about to end. I have a job offer but I cannot work now. Do I have to leave the country?
First of all, I donu2019t understand why you have to leave the country. If the EAD card was approved that means that USCIS is working on your case and thatu2019s a good reason to not leave the country. The EAD card might have been returned to the USCIS because of the mistake with the address or the delivery person couldnu2019t access your mail box and then sent it back to the sender who is in this case USCIS.Just contact USCIS which your case number or receipt number and explain to them what happened, they will be able to send it back again to you and they will verify the address if this was the reason why your EAD was returned back to them.Regarding your job offer, you can try and explain to them the situation and show them some document which shows that your EAD was approved but just undelivered hopefully they will be able to wait untill you get your EAD card.Good luck.
